What is a Latex Mattress?
A latex mattress is made of natural latex, obtained from the sap of rubber trees. It is valued for its support and breathability and for excellent durability. Latex mattresses can be made of 100 percent natural latex, or synthetic or blended latex may be added in order to increase specific properties such as firmness or elasticity.
There is also quality variation based on the source of latex and process, making natural latex mattresses particularly popular for their eco-friendly factors. Natural latex mattresses give a responsive surface even as they conform to the body; it therefore offers excellent support, primarily to back or joint-plagued individuals.

4. Dunlop vs. Talalay Latex Mattresses
Dunlop and Talalay are two different processes involved in the making of latex mattresses. Dunlop latex is thicker and harder; therefore, for those requiring extra support, it is excellent to use. Talalay has a softer, more even feel and is mostly found in comfort layers. Most of the best types of latex mattresses available in India combine Dunlop and Talalay latex in order to achieve a perfectly balanced support and softness.
Tips for Selecting the Best Latex Mattress in India
Determine your comfort and support requirements
If you require strong support, a firmer mattress made from Dunlop latex would be best. If you prefer a softer or cushiony feel, look for Talalay latex at the top layers of the mattress.
Check on the Certifications
Look for certifications such as GOLS (Global Organic Latex Standard) or OEKO-TEX Standard 100, which indicates that the latex used is organic or nontoxic.
Natural, Synthetic, or Blended Latex
Natural latex is not only more eco-friendly and long-lasting but also pricey. A better compromise is a blended latex mattress; a synthetic latex mattress gives affordability and less focus on environmental benefits.
Mattress Firmness
Latex mattresses also vary in firmness. The right firmness will depend on your sleeping position and personal preference for comfort. For their part, back and stomach sleepers prefer firmer mattresses, while side sleepers might appreciate a softer mattress, giving way to the shoulders and hips.
Thicker is Better
Natural latex mattresses vary in thickness. For maximum comfort, a minimum thickness of 8 inches is advisable, while those needing more support or pressure relief can be provided with an additional layer.
